• ベストアンサー

エクセルデータを所属毎に別ファイルにする方法を教えてください。

EXCELのことでお伺いいたします。 あるお客様(50店舗くらいを経営している飲食店)の給与計算を担当しています。 全従業員の賃金台帳(エクセル)を作成後、店長に内容を確認してもらうために各店舗番号でフィルタをかけ、コピペで別のファイルを作り、メールで送っています。 他の店舗の従業員の明細が見えてしまうとまずいので、その店舗に所属する従業員の給与だけ確認してもらうようにしています。 コピペで別のファイルを50個作るのが非常に面倒なのですが、このような作業が自動的にできる方法はありますか? パソコンについて、詳しくないので、的外れな質問かもしれないのですが、 ご回答いただけますと助かります。よろしくお願い致します。

質問者が選んだベストアンサー

  • ベストアンサー
  • spocky
  • ベストアンサー率100% (1/1)
回答No.2

私は,ほぼ質問ばかりで,回答する技量もないので以下をご紹介したいと思うのですが・・・ Excelのことは↓で質問してみてはどうでしょうか・・・ Excelだけに特化してあるので,今までの質問・回答にあるかも知れません。レスポンスも早いですよ。 (参)http://www.ichikura.com/cgi-bin/tbbs/tbbs.cgi?cmd=parent

参考URL:
http://www.ichikura.com/cgi-bin/tbbs/tbbs.cgi?cmd=parent
denkodenko
質問者

お礼

どうもありがとうございます。 こちらでも聞いてみたいと思います。 ありがとうございました!!

denkodenko
質問者

補足

ご紹介いただいたサイトに相談してみました。 初めてのVBAでしたが、とても親切に対応していただき、 解決することができました。 本当に助かりました。ありがとうございました。

その他の回答 (2)

noname#170371
noname#170371
回答No.3

単純にVBA(Visual BASIC for Applications)でコード作成して実行すれば 良いのでは? 記載されている内容の範囲なら「記録」したコードを元にちょっと改造すれば 出来そうな気がしますよ

denkodenko
質問者

お礼

ありがとうございます! VBAって聞いたことがある程度です・・・ 初心者でも本読んでできますか?? よろしくお願い致します。

回答No.1

まず、どういった所が面倒で どういったに悩んでらっしゃるのかが わかりませんが、ファイルを50個も作る必要は無いですよね? 1つのファイルで コピペして 名前を変更して 送って 確認する時は 送信済のメールの添付を見ればOK! コピペ自体は Ctrl + A で全部選択出来ますから そんなに大変な作業でもないでしょうし。 全部を一度に確認したい場合は全部のシートを1つのファイルにまとめておけばOKですよね。 もっと便利な方法もきっとあるでしょうが 僕が今考えられる事は この程度って事で悪しからず。。。。

denkodenko
質問者

お礼

ご回答ありがとうございます! 「1つのファイルで コピペして 名前を変更して 送って 確認する時は 送信済のメールの添付を見ればOK!」 一応店舗に送ったファイルはフォルダに保存しておきたいのです。 送る前にファイルごとにパスワードをかける必要もありまして・・・ もう少し調べてみます。 ありがとうございました。

関連するQ&A